Green Growth is a team volunteering project implemented within the framework of the European Solidarity Corps. The project takes place in a small rural town of Cristuru Secuiesc and its surrounding villages. It focuses on two main objectives. We aim to provide young people living in rural areas with knowledge and practical skills related to sustainability, recycling, and environmental responsibility. Many of them have limited access to learning opportunities in these topics, so we will use non-formal education methods such as workshops, interactive activities, and community events. Second, we will organize community clean-up actions and actively involve at least 200 local participants alongside international volunteers. To support these goals, we will also launch a communication campaign to raise awareness and promote environmentally friendly habits within the wider community. The house is fully furnished and equipped with a spacious kitchen including 3 fridges, a stove, microwave, dishes, and all necessary furniture. There are two bathrooms with toilets, showers, a washing machine, and cleaning appliances. The house has five large bedrooms with beds and furniture, plus electricity, gas, hot and cold water, and Wi-Fi. Each volunteer receives €139.95 duration of the project food and pocket money. All accommodation and utility costs are covered, and international travel is reimbursed.

Selected volunteers will take part in several trainings. Before the project, they join an online pre-departure training covering basic Hungarian language, non-formal education and local culture. After arrival, an on-arrival training helps them get to know each other, the venue and deepen prior knowledge. At the end, a final evaluation training supports reflection on how to use the gained knowledge and experience in the future.

We are looking for young people aged 18–30 who are interested in sustainability and recycling, are not afraid to get their hands dirty, and are motivated to work with communities that have fewer opportunities. Ideal candidates enjoy teamwork but are also capable of implementing their own ideas independently.
